Defining Targets and Evaluating Outcomes: The Quarterly Performance Check-In

The annual performance review process enables a structured framework for employees and managers to collaborate on progress, achievements, and future goals. A key element of this process is the creation of spec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ound (SMART) goals. These goals function as a roadmap for employee development and organizational success. During the review, employees have the chance to analyze their performance against these goals and obtain valuable feedback from their managers. Furthermore, the process involves a comprehensive evaluation of employee contributions, highlighting both strengths and areas for improvement.

  • By clearly defining expectations and providing frequent feedback, the performance review process fosters a culture of open communication.
  • This also acts as a valuable tool for identifying training and development needs, ensuring employees have the competencies required to succeed.
  • Ultimately, the annual performance review process is a vital element in driving employee engagement and achieving organizational goals.

Fostering High Performance: A Guide to Meaningful Reviews

Conducting successful performance reviews is crucial for fostering a culture of growth and advancement. These assessments should be more than just periodic check-ins; they are valuable opportunities to provide constructive feedback, acknowledge achievements, and actively establish goals for the future.

  • Guarantee that the review process is open and harmonized with company goals.
  • Collect comprehensive information to support your feedback, emphasizing both strengths and areas for development.
  • Involve in a two-way dialogue, encouraging the employee to express their perspectives and goals.
  • Formulate a strategy for future development, outlining specific steps to address areas for improvement.

By implementing these practices, you can transform performance reviews into valuable experiences that inspire employees and contribute to their success.
